Output 216615255e5750e22078f790c55591544524ffc7d0a9d478d1c05a0fc6b99b95:0

value
676002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68800d1417b57e1fa7c67f378343180acddda4b9 OP_EQUAL
address
3BDZbe48Vx7Vcy9paAQmguA2Mjb1kzVenY
transaction
216615255e5750e22078f790c55591544524ffc7d0a9d478d1c05a0fc6b99b95
spent
true